I think I bit off more than I could chew with this retrofit...
I installed all the programs I was so ready.

I have a 2015 535. 10/2014 build date.
LCI Adaptive xenon.
FRM3 with the 2 row SWE.
ZGW-02 8SK.

Trying to retrofit adaptive LEDS..

TLDR: I have STMR and STML modules but I do not have my LHM modules showing up.

Tis is shut down and I can't get wiring diagrams anywhere now for my car and donor car lights. (Got lucky enough to get the vin from the seller of the lights) I'm not sure what I'm missing..
I was following a different thread on how to do this. Person had a LCI Adaptive Xenon and apparently only needed to add two wires for pin 3 on R/L headlight. I believe I am prewired for pin 5 like in the other thread. When I pulled fuse 127, 108 (if I remember correctly) both headlights went out.

Anyway I ran the two wires, one from trunk fuse box, one from front junction box, I took the two pins out of the FRM on both connectors. (6 and 38)

So I only ran two like the guide I was following. I did not run 4 wires from the ZGW that I saw in the other posts on this thread.

After I wired everything up...
And here's where I realized I shouldn't have started this. (No coding experience..)
Anyway, open up Esys, (saved like every file 5 different times) VO code delete 524 add 552, then I went to VCM write fp, go back to coding and hit code on frm. (Did save svt backup before obviously since i don't know what I'm doing)

Aaand then plugged headlights in after reading vo codes to make sure adaptive led code is still there

Anyway, I'm not really sure how I got my headlights to turn on... but the angel eyes and drl turned on. I believe I hit "code" on both of the TMS modules..
Check ISTA, the CAFD files were added to the STMR and STML.

The actual headlights did not turn on though (low beam) I'm assuming because of the LHM ecus.

I'm now having an issue that I don't see my LHM ecu's... I did not "flash" my zgw ecu. (At this point things just got scary so I just stopped immediately...) I felt comfortable enough to edit the VO codes and that's about it, haha..
